提交 72317535 编写于 作者: O openharmony_ci 提交者: Gitee

!179 修改用例testWmemchr可能存在数组越界的问题

Merge pull request !179 from chuaizhzh/kernel_lite_20210430_02
......@@ -246,11 +246,11 @@ HWTEST_F(IoTest, testWmemset, Function | MediumTest | Level1)
HWTEST_F(IoTest, testWmemchr, Function | MediumTest | Level1)
{
wchar_t src[] = L"hello world";
wchar_t *ret = wmemchr(src, L' ', sizeof(src));
wchar_t *ret = wmemchr(src, L' ', sizeof(src) / sizeof(src[0]) - 1);
EXPECT_STREQ(ret, L" world");
wchar_t srcT[] = L"this is string";
ret = wmemchr(srcT, L'?', sizeof(srcT));
ret = wmemchr(srcT, L'?', sizeof(srcT) / sizeof(srcT[0]) - 1);
EXPECT_STREQ(ret, nullptr);
}
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册